Overview Podbook 50mg Dry Syrup

Podbook 50mg oral suspension is an antibacterial medication used to treat various bacterial infections in children and adolescents. It effectively combats infections affecting the ears, eyes, nose, throat, lungs, skin, digestive system, and urinary tract, including typhoid fever. Administer one hour before or two hours after meals; if stomach upset occurs, give with food. Always adhere to the prescribed dosage, tailored to the infection's severity, your child's age, and weight. If your child vomits the medicine within 30 minutes, repeat the dose; however, avoid doubling if it's near the next scheduled dose. Do not use for viral illnesses like colds and flu; it's only appropriate for coughs and colds with a confirmed secondary bacterial infection. Mild, temporary side effects such as n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, rash, and headache may occur, usually resolving as the body adjusts. Persistent or severe side effects warrant immediate medical attention. Inform your child's doctor about your child's complete medical history, including allergies, heart conditions, blood disorders, congenital defects, respiratory issues, lung abnormalities, digestive problems, skin conditions, liver or kidney dysfunction. This information is vital for accurate dosing and comprehensive treatment planning.

How to use Podbook 50mg Dry Syrup:

Administer this medication according to your physician's prescribed dosage and schedule. Consult the product label for complete instructions prior to consumption. The powder should be dissolved in sterile water, thoroughly mixed, and then ingested. Consume Podbook 50mg Dry Syrup with food.

How Podbook 50mg Dry Syrup works:

Podbook 50mg Dry Syrup is an antibiotic that inhibits bacterial growth by disrupting the synthesis of their protective cell walls. This action prevents bacterial proliferation and the spread of infection, while avoiding the development of antibiotic resistance.

SAFETY ADVICE

KidneyKid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Podbook 50mg Dry Syrup poses no safety concerns for patients with kidney impairment; no dosage alteration is typically necessary. Nevertheless, children exhibiting severe kidney disease might necessitate adjusted dosages.

LiverLiverCAUTION

Patients with liver impairment should use Podbook 50mg Dry Syrup cautiously, as d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.

What if you forget to take Podbook 50mg Dry Syrup :

Remain calm. Unless otherwise directed by your pediatrician, administer the forgotten dose immediately upon recollection. However, omit the missed dose if the next scheduled dose is imminent. Continue adhering to the prescribed medication schedule; avoid doubling the dose to compensate.

FAQs on Podbook 50mg Dry Syrup

While an extra dose of Podbook 50mg Dry Syrup is probably harmless, contact a doctor immediately if you suspect an overdose. Overdosing could trigger adverse reactions and potentially worsen your child's condition.
This medication may cause serious side effects such as persistent vomiting, kidney problems, allergic reactions, diarrhea, and severe gastrointestinal infections. Consult your child's doctor immediately if any of these occur.
Podbook 50mg Dry Syrup may interact with other medications. Inform your child's doctor about all other medications your child is taking before starting Podbook 50mg Dry Syrup, and always consult your child's doctor before administering any medication.
Generally, antibiotics don't interact negatively with vaccines or cause adverse reactions in recently vaccinated children. However, vaccination should be postponed until a child recovers from an illness requiring antibiotics. The vaccine can be administered once your child is well.
Your child's doctor might recommend regular kidney and liver function tests to monitor their health.
A yellow or green nasal discharge doesn't automatically require antibiotics. This color change is a normal part of a common cold, as mucus thickens over time. Cold symptoms typically resolve within 7-10 days.
Viral infections, such as sore throats and ear infections, account for over 80% of cases, rendering antibiotics ineffective. Symptoms like sore throat, runny nose, barking cough, earache, and ear discharge strongly suggest a viral cause. Always consult your pediatrician for diagnosis and treatment.
Viral infections typically aren't followed by bacterial infections. Antibiotics are ineffective against viruses and may harm your child if used unnecessarily. Always consult your child's doctor before using antibiotics.
Antibiotics, including Podbook 50mg Dry Syrup, can upset children's stomachs by harming beneficial gut bacteria. This may increase the risk of further infections. If your child experiences diarrhea while taking Podbook 50mg Dry Syrup, don't stop the medication; contact your doctor for guidance on how to proceed, including potential dosage adjustments.
Yes, inconsistent use, overuse, and misuse of Podbook 50mg Dry Syrup can foster antibiotic resistance. This means the antibiotics become ineffective, potentially causing reinfection.
